Brett Farmer

A nice sport bar. They have a ton of TVs so you will find your game on one of them. There are also bar games in the back room in case you are looking for something fun.The chicken fingers are awesome as many others have said. I would def recommend them. They have a nice selection of dipping sauces as well.They had at least 10 beers on tap which was great. They even had Yuengling Hershey's which I have never seen outside of PA! It is a must try holiday beer. The bartenders were nice and fast.Parking: Large parking lot just outside the frontKid-friendliness: I have seen a fair number of families here. The food is good so that makes sense. It isn't really a rowdy place so this would be a pretty decent place to bring kids.Wheelchair accessibility: Wheelchair accessible entrance. The bar will be a little high, but there are ample tables
